New Student Housing Questionnaire
Think carefully about your responses, as they will effect where you are placed. Your responses to the questions will be considered in relation to each other as we make your housing selection. Assignments will be made primarily on the compatibility of personal living habits and interests based on your answers to the questions below. It is very important that you answer all these questions honestly to assist us in selecting a roommate for you. Keep in mind that most new students are assigned to a one-room double with a roommate.

Note: Many of you may not have had the opportunity to visit our first-year residences -- while their architecture differs somewhat, all have been renovated or completely rebuilt within the last several years, and offer similar accommodations. All of our first-year residences have elevators, single-sex bathrooms, internet access, and study lounges. Keep in mind that nearly all rooms in first-year housing are one-room doubles so you will most likely have a roommate.
